If a relation R is defined on the set Z of integers as follows:
(a, b) ∈ R ⇔ a2 + b2 = 25. Then, domain (R) is ___________
विकल्प
{3, 4, 5}
{0, 3, 4, 5}
{0, ±3, ±4, ±5}
None of these
Advertisements
उत्तर
{0, ± 3, ± 4, ± 5}
R={ (a, b) : a2 + b2 =25, a, b ∈ Z }
⇒ a ∈ {−5, −4, −3, −2, −1, 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5} and
b ∈ {−5, −4, −3, −2, −1, 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5}
So, domain (R)= {0, ±3, ±4, ±5}
